Idea for NPC-owned, Player-worked businesses

The Idea:
--All shops would be Owned by the NPC Server, but players could still work at them (like Speedy Pizza)

--Business Levels
-Each time a player is the top worker for the week, they gain a level with the business.
(of course, this could be made to use an experience system, instead of a top worker of the week system, which is more granular and allows more people share in the profit, but profit share would be lower for everyone.)
-Each level gives the player more percentage of the profits for the week from the business.
-The highest level player in a given business is awarded the owner rank.
(The owner could be given additional rewards or perks.)
(And I guess by extension, that makes the second-place worker Co-Owner)

--Profit Distribution
-All of the money earned by a business in a week is put in the safe and divided amongst the players with levels in the business at the end of the week
-Whatever percentage of the total levels in the business you have, that's what percentage of the profit you will receive.
-As an example:
-There are 10 people that are level 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, and 10
-That's a total of 55 levels.
-The person who is level 10 has 18.18% of the total levels, therefore
receives 18.18% of the profits from the business.
-The person who is level 1 has 1.81% of the total levels, therefore
receives 1.81% of the profits from the business.

--Worker Pay
-Pay is immediate
-Pay does not come from business profits (like Speedy Pizza, it's just spawned.)

------------------------------
This solves the problem of Business Owner drama (Picking a business owner fairly, business owners making too much money, business owners running a business poorly, etc.)

Whoever is the best worker in a business is the owner of the business, and whoever dedicates time and effort to working at a business will receive their fair share of profit.

Also, if an "owner" or someone with levels in a business gets lazy, they risk losing a portion of their share in the profit.

Actually we have a very good start on a new business system being worked on in dev. The goal is to eliminate the owner and allow the highest rank to be manager. No one gets access to the safe, everything in the business is controlled through a GUI. The only thing the manager has control over is hiring new employees, when to pay employees (simple button that just pays everyone), and what items the shop sells. This way everyone only gets paid for what they actually do. Now the whole idea with allowing the manager to change guns all depends on if their business owns the licenses to produce the weapon. How will licenses be purchased? Glad you you asked, since every business usually always has money laying around, the extra money in the safe would go towards business licenses.

Obviously there is still a lot of work to be done with this. So if anyone has any suggestions now would be the time.

Licenses should be limited and should have to be bid on by businesses on a weekly basis.

In Jenn's business system once a business owned a license they owned it forever, but the first business to buy a certain gun license always made an absolute killing the first couple of weeks and paid for the license a thousand times over.

If only 2 businesses were allowed to make handgun ammo each week then they'd have to bid against eachother aggressively to win the license, which drives up the ongoing cost of running the business and eats into the whole "pure profits" scenario.

Also pay should be done instantly. There's no reason why players should have to wait and be paid manually, and instant pay gives finer control over the business.
The manager should just set a prices that the business buys minerals for and the pay per item to be stocked. This way if they desperately need iron they can set the buy price for iron at $10 each and the market will respond INSTANTLY. Or if they have way too many handgun ammo stocked and not enough grenades they can change the pay for those and the stockers should switch INSTANTLY.
